Window Solutions: Enhancing Your Home's Aesthetics and Efficiency
Windows are often considered the eyes of a home, offering natural light, fresh air, and an inviting view of the outdoors. Nevertheless, they are not simply structural elements; they are essential to a building's exterior, energy effectiveness, and security. In this article, we will check out various window solutions, their benefits, and considerations to optimize their efficiency while enhancing the aesthetics of your residential or commercial property.

Windows come in a variety of designs and functionalities, each contributing uniquely to a structure's performance and visual appeal. Below is an overview of the most common types of Window Contractor solutions:
1.1. Standard Windows
These include double-hung, single-hung, casement, awning, and sliding windows. Standard windows can be made from various materials, such as vinyl, wood, or aluminum, and match different architectural styles.
1.2. Energy-efficient Windows
Developed with advanced glazing strategies and insulation, energy-efficient windows lower energy loss and help maintain stable indoor temperature levels. They normally have a low-E (low emissivity) finishing that shows infrared light while allowing visible light to get in.

These consist of custom-shaped windows like pentagonal, circle-top, or seasonal windows. Specialty windows are typically used to include special architectural style or to fit non-traditional areas.
1.4. Smart Windows
Smart windows employ innovation to manage the quantity of light and heat that goes through. These windows can instantly tint in action to sunlight or be from another location managed via smart home systems.
2. Benefits of Upgrading Your Windows
Upgrading windows can yield numerous benefits, including but not limited to:
Energy Efficiency: Improved insulation can lead to lower energy expenses and boosted convenience inside your home.Visual Appeal: Modern Window Installation windows can dramatically uplift the appearance of a home, enhancing its curb appeal.Increased Property Value: High-quality window solutions can make homes more attractive to possible buyers.Improved Security: Many modern windows come with robust locking systems and shatter-resistant glass.Sound Reduction: Quality windows can minimize external sound pollution, creating a more relaxing living environment.3. Considerations When Choosing Windows
Picking the best windows involves taking a look at several aspects:
Climate: Different windows fit various environments. For instance, homes in warm areas might benefit more from low-E windows.Spending plan: Window solutions can differ considerably in price. It's essential to balance quality with affordability.Design and style: The design of windows should match the architectural design of the home.Maintenance: Consider the long-lasting maintenance needed for the picked window product.Tips for Choosing the Right WindowsExamine the local environment's influence on efficiency.Conduct a cost-benefit analysis of energy cost savings.Refer to customer reviews and testimonials of window makers.Speak with a professional for custom solutions.4. FAQs about Window SolutionsWhat is the life-span of modern windows?
Most modern windows can last in between 15 to 30 years, depending on the materials utilized and environmental conditions.
How can I inform if my windows require replacement?
Indications may consist of drafts, condensation between the panes, or visible fading of interior home furnishings due to UV exposure.
Are energy-efficient windows actually worth the investment?
Yes; while they may have a greater in advance cost, the long-term savings on energy expenses and enhanced comfort often validate the financial investment.
What are the very best window designs for energy performance?
Double or triple-glazed windows with low-E coatings are thought about amongst the best options for energy efficiency.
Can windows be fixed rather of replaced?
Sometimes, repair work can be made, such as changing weather removing or re-sealing. Nevertheless, if windows are considerably old or harmed, replacement might be the better alternative.
